Ambient Backscatter Communications for Future Ultra-Low-Power Machine Type Communications: Challenges, Solutions, Opportunities, and Future Research Trends

Ruifeng Duan, Xiyu Wang, Hüseyi̇n Yi̇ği̇tler, Muhammad Usman Sheikh, Riku Jäntti, Zhu Han

2020IEEE Communications Magazine94 citationsDOIOpen Access PDF

Abstract

The widespread applications of massive MTC are limited by energy availability, spectrum congestion, and device costs. The emerging AmBC not only addresses these bottlenecks but also opens opportunities for new applications. This article aims to explore AmBC-enhanced future ultra-low-power MTC. In this context, we present the development trends in AmBC prototype designs and discuss potential applications, highlight the specific features of the AmBC technology, and review AmBC receiver designs. Finally, we investigate and outline the future research challenges and trends from the practical aspects of AmBC systems.
